complibs/ppl: update GMP location configuration argument for PPL v0.11 and later

'configure' for PPL 0.11 (and later) needs "--with-gmp-prefix" to
provide the location of the GMP toolkit; the previous switches were
"--with-libgmp-prefix" and "--with-libgmpxx-prefix".

The upstream log message is:

commit 08dfb6fea094f8c5a533575a3ea2095edce99a6d
Author: Roberto Bagnara <bagnara@cs.unipr.it>
Date: Sun Jul 12 21:39:46 2009 +0200

New configure option --with-gmp-prefix supersedes the (now removed)
options --with-libgmp-prefix and --with-libgmpxx-prefix.

Link: http://www.cs.unipr.it/git/gitweb.cgi?p=ppl/ppl.git;a=commit;h=08dfb6fea094f8c5a533575a3ea2095edce99a6d

Since PPL's 'configure' ignores unknown switches, we use all three so we
don't have to conditionalize the ppl.sh build script itself.
